Output 6a98baf39f632b7540f16d0eb289001b3af559a99b7c766efcc98b146dae6743:11

value
500000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ccbff839e7a6bf2814160f14350b7f8c518e67d99426f934eaa49bb896024486
address
bc1pejllsw0856ljs9qkpu2r2zml33gcue7ejsn0jd825jdm39szgjrq2v95r9
transaction
6a98baf39f632b7540f16d0eb289001b3af559a99b7c766efcc98b146dae6743
confirmations
60124
spent
true